Creating File Resources

To create a File Resource, go to Setup β†’ File Resources and click the NEW button.

Fill in these fields:

  • Select Actor: select the Actor to which the File Resource will be applied.

  • Name: assign a unique name of the File Resource. These characters are accepted / ! * + ? = " | Blanks are not accepted.

  • Description: enter a description for the File Resource.

  • Reject File: YES or NO (default). Select if a file matching the File Processing Rule associated with this File Resource will be accepted (NO, default) or not (YES).

  • Local Settings have two different configurable platforms where they can operate, with different properties: WINDOWS / UNIX LIKE and zOS. The Remote Settings configuration has the same properties and definitions as the Local Settings.

FILE FORMAT – RECORD FORMAT

The record format:

UF – Windows/”Unix like” Fixed length

The file consists of fixed-length records

UV – Windows/”Unix like” delimited with EOL

The file consists of variable-length text records delimited by a line end an end of line

UVL – Windows/”Unix like” length prefixed variable record (big-endian)

The file consists of records of variable length, and each record is preceded by its length (4 big-endian binary bytes)

NONE – Not Set (default)

The file does not consist of any records

DISPOSITION RULES – PUT DISPOSITION

The disposition applicable only to the external file:

REJECT_IF_EXIST

Create a new file. This operation fails if the file already exists

OVERRIDE (default)

Replace or create a new file if it does not exist

NEW_VERSION

Same as OVERRIDE, it can reuse the space allocation for zOS dataset

REPLACE_NO_CREATE

Replace an old file. This operation fails if the file does not exist

DISPOSITION RULES – GET DISPOSITION

When the platform works as a server, the file can remain on the VFS or can be removed automatically once it is successfully pulled by a client. When the platform works as a client, the file can remain on the VFS or can be removed automatically once it is successfully read to be pushed via a Client Connection. The configuration occurs choosing the option:

LEAVE

The file remains in the VFS

REMOVE (default)

The file is removed from the VFS

FILE FORMAT – RESOURCE BLOCK SIZE

The block size (used when the record format is zOS type).

FILE FORMAT – RECORD LENGTH

Record length: this is mandatory if the record format is ZFxx/ZVxx

FILE ALLOCATION SETTINGS – SPACE TYPE

Use the SPACE parameter to request space for a new data set on a direct access volume: B Byte KB Kilo byte MB Mega Byte GB Giga Byte CYL Cylinders TRK Tracks BLK Blocks

FILE ALLOCATION SETTINGS – PRIMARY SPACE

Specifies the number of tracks, cylinders, blocks, or records to be allocated.

FILE ALLOCATION SETTINGS – SECONDARY SPACE

Specifies the number of additional tracks, cylinders, blocks, or records to be allocated, if more space is needed.

FILE ALLOCATION SETTINGS – UNIT

Use the UNIT parameter to specify a device for an SMS-managed data set.

FILE ALLOCATION SETTINGS – VOLUME LIST

Use the VOLUME parameter to identify the volume or volumes where a data set resides or will reside. Each volume must be separated by commas [ , ].

FILE ALLOCATION SETTINGS – DATA CLASS

Use the DATACLASS parameter to specify a data class for a new data set. The storage administrator at your installation defines the names of the data classes you can code on the DATACLASS parameter.

During the definition of the File Resource, some checks are performed against local and remote settings to assure data consistency. These are the basic rules:

  • Local and Remote content types must both refer to binary or text files. In other words, a binary local content type and a text remote content type cannot be defined.

  • If the content type is text, the Charset name definition is mandatory.

  • If the record format is UV, the content type needs to refer to a text file, and the resource End of Line is mandatory.

  • If the record format refers to a fixed or variable length record, the record length is mandatory, and the resource End of Line is forbidden.

  • If the content type is binary, text-specific attributes cannot be specified, e.g., charset name and resource End of Line.
